#03d501 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#03d501 is composed of 1.2% red, 83.5%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.5%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 119.4 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 42%. #03d501 color hex could be obtained by blending #06ff02 with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

Shades and Tints of #03d501
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001200 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#03d501
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#647264 is the less saturated color, while #03d501 is the most saturated one.
